Activities such as dramatic play have been essential in our program, as the play assists the students to process new and familiar situations, show interest in and make connections to life skills and develop strategies to engage and play co-operatively with others.  

 

The addition of a hair dressing corner has been highly sort after by many of our students. It will be a wonderful social and regulation tool for the children as well as gaining some incredible fine motor strength and co-ordination.  This will also help the children in their endeavour to progress through the steps to tie their shoe laces independently and improve their legibility and stamina when writing.
